How much do wind tech j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for wind tech in Virginia is $22.88,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.61 and $26.68 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Wind Techs?

Wind Techs, short for Wind Turbine Technicians, are skilled professionals who install, maintain, and repair wind turbines. They ensure that wind turbines operate efficiently by performing routine inspections, troubleshooting mechanical and electrical issues, and replacing faulty components. Wind Techs often work at heights and in varying weather conditions, making safety a critical part of their job. Their work is essential to keeping wind farms running smoothly and contributing to renewable energy production.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Wind Tech,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Wind Tech, you need mechanical aptitude, technical troubleshooting skills, and a background in electrical or mechanical engineering, often supported by a technical certificate or associate degree. Proficiency with diagnostic tools, SCADA systems, and safety equipment is essential in this role. Str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ective teamwork are crucial soft skills. These competencies ensure safe, efficient maintenance of wind turbines and contribute to reliable renewable energy production.

What are some common challenges faced by Wind Technicians, and how can new hires prepare for them?

Wind Technicians often encounter challenges such as working at significant heights, performing maintenance in varying weather conditions, and troubleshooting complex mechanical or electrical issues. New hires can prepare by completing safety certifications, becoming comfortable with climbing and physical tasks, and gaining a solid understanding of electrical and mechanical systems. Teamwork is also essential, as most maintenance and repair tasks are performed in pairs or small groups to ensure safety and efficiency.

Job Description
The Project Executive is a senior leader within Apex Clean Energy's Engineering & Construction division, responsible for the successful execution of multiple utility-scale renewable energy projects, including wind, solar, and battery energy storage systems (BESS). Reporting to the Vice President of Construction, this role provides strategic oversight and leadership across multiple concurrent projects or large, complex developments from pre-construction through commissioning and commercial operation.
The Project Executive serves as a key driver of project performance, ensuring alignment with Apex's standards for safety, quality, cost, and schedule, while supporting the company's mission to accelerate the shift to clean energy.
Primary Responsibilities
  • Lead the execution of multiple, or single large utility-scale wind, solar, and BESS projects, ensuring delivery from pre-construction through COD in alignment with Apex's development and operational objectives.
  • Provide direct leadership and oversight to project managers, and construction management teams across multiple active project sites.
  • Partner closely with Development, Engineering, Procurement, and Asset Management teams to ensure seamless project handoff, execution, and operational readiness.
  • Establish and maintain project governance, reporting, and performance tracking to ensure transparency and accountability across all assigned projects.
  • Drive execution strategies, including contracting models (EPC, multi-contract, hybrid approaches), construction sequencing, and resource planning.
  • Maintain full accountability for project budgets, schedules, and risk profiles, proactively identifying and mitigating execution risks.
  • Support and influence procurement strategies alongside Supply Chain, including major equipment sourcing (turbines, modules, inverters, BESS systems) and logistics planning.
  • Lead commercial negotiations and oversight of EPC agreements, major equipment supply contracts, and construction services.
  • Ensure compliance with all permitting, environmental, and regulatory requirements, as well as Apex's internal standards and procedures.
  • Serve as a senior representative to internal leadership, providing regular updates to the VP of Construction and executive team on project status, risks, and performance metrics.
  • Foster a culture of safety excellence, quality execution, and continuous improvement across all project teams and sites.
  • Support the transition of projects to Asset Management, ensuring operational readiness and performance optimization post-COD.
